A blend of 67% Cabernet Sauvignon, 23% Merlot, 5% Cabernet Franc and 5% Petit Verdot, this is a dark, rich and layered wine which displays savory herb, black currant, blackberry, cedar and anise aromas. It is full-bodied, round, moderately tannic and packed with ripe black fruit on the palate. The alcohol (listed as 14.1%) is seamless and the middle palate is solid. Lengthy and smooth on the finish, this leaves the taster wondering how this wine has flown under the radar. If you can find it, you will not be disappointed by this well-priced offering. Drink now-2020.
